Use this guide to replace the battery in your Turtle Beach Ear Force Stealth 500P headphones.

Remove the ear pad from the earphone by gently pulling the cloth pad outwards from the slot holding the cloth.
-
Work circularly until removed.
-
-
-
Using a Phillips #1 screwdriver, remove the four fastening screws that hold the blue plastic speaker mount in place.
-
Gently pull blue plastic from black housing by hand until separated.
-
-
-
Use screwdriver tip J00 to remove three screws fastening circuit board to casing.
-
-
-

-
Use bent tweezers to remove two wire connector plugs from circuit board.
-
-
-
Circuit board will be free to be removed by hand. Use plastic pry tool to slide between casing and circuit board if needed.
-
-
-
Gently removed and flip over circuit board to reveal battery pack attached to the underside. Careful not to pull out wires running through headband.
-
-
-
Use metal pry tool to slide between battery and circuit board to break up adhesive. Ensure the battery wire connector plug has been removed on front side.
-
-
-
Battery will be free to be removed and replaced.
-
To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order.

Where can I get a replacement battery?
You can look on Ebay or Amazon. You can find it by searching the model number: ( FT603048P )
The costs are like $20-$30.
If you look on Ebay under: ( 3.7v 603048 ), you can get the same battery without the connector for like $5.
